Technical Field
[0001] The utility model relates to the technical field of daily necessities, in particular to a portable toothbrush. Background Art
[0002] When people go on business trips or travel in their daily lives, they often carry toothbrushes as personal belongings. Since the toothbrush heads of household toothbrushes are exposed, it is not easy to carry them when going out. Therefore, special portable toothbrushes are needed to meet people's needs.
[0003] Existing portable toothbrushes use a design in which the toothbrush head and the toothbrush handle can be separated. When in use, the toothbrush head and the handle are plugged in. After use, the brush head needs to be pulled out and then reversely inserted into the inside of the handle to protect the toothbrush head.
[0004] The existing portable toothbrush needs to be repeatedly pulled out and inserted into the toothbrush head during use, which is inconvenient to use and the operation process is cumbersome. Therefore, we propose a portable toothbrush. Utility Model Content

[0026] The working principle of a portable toothbrush provided by the present invention is as follows: when using the portable toothbrush, the pressing plate 4 is pressed to the left, and the pressing plate 4 moves to the left, driving the sliding block 32 to move to the left, so that the sliding column 33 slides toward the inside of the fixed cylinder 34, and the spring 2 35 contracts. At this time, the right side of the sliding block 32 slides inside the I-shaped limiting groove 31. At this time, the pressing plate 4 is pushed upward, and the pressing plate 4 drives the sliding block 32 to move upward, so that the sliding column 33 moves upward, and drives the fixed cylinder 34 to move upward, so that the mounting seat 7 moves upward. At this time, the right side of the sliding block 32 slides in the vertical groove of the I-shaped limiting groove 31. When the sliding block 32 slides to the uppermost end of the I-shaped limiting groove 31, the pressing plate 4 is released, and the spring 2 35 is relaxed, pushing the sliding column 33 to move to the right, driving the sliding block 32 to move to the right , so that the left side of the sliding block 32 is located in the horizontal groove on the upper side of the I-shaped limit groove 31, and at the same time, the mounting seat 7 moves upward to drive the plastic elastic card block 1 5 to be connected to the inside of the vertically adjacent plastic elastic card block 2 6. At the same time, the mounting seat 7 moves upward to drive the toothbrush head 8 to move upward, so that the toothbrush head 8 pushes the protective cover 2 upward, so that the protective cover 2 is opened, and the toothbrush head 8 extends out of the handle 1. When the toothbrush head 8 needs to be replaced, the sliding card block 11 is pressed to the left, and the spring 12 contracts to disengage the upper end of the sliding card block 11 from the card slot and pull the toothbrush head 8 out upward. After replacing the new toothbrush head 8, the toothbrush head 8 is inserted into the slot, and the sliding card block 11 is released. The spring 12 relaxes, pushing the sliding card block 11 to move to the right, so that the upper end of the sliding card block 11 is inserted into the card slot, and the replacement of the toothbrush head 8 is completed.
